There are 587,768 people in the Denver metro area who speak a non-English language at home.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au, 2024 American Community Survey 1-year estimates.

The 15 most spoken languages after English in the Denver metro area

  1. 1Spanish376,142
  2. 2Chinese19,115
  3. 3Amharic, Somali & other Afro-Asiatic16,644
  4. 4Russian14,375
  5. 5French12,491
  6. 6Vietnamese12,034
  7. 7Korean10,981
  8. 8Arabic9,302
  9. 9German9,100
  10. 10Nepali, Marathi & other Indic9,048
  11. 11Hindi8,311
  12. 12Yoruba, Twi, Igbo & other West African7,884
  13. 13Portuguese7,137
  14. 14Swahili & other African languages6,380
  15. 15Tagalog6,179

20%

of Denver metro area residents speak a language other than English at home.

221,076

Denver metro area residents speak English less than “very well”: the federal threshold for needing language assistance.

#60

highest limited-English share for the Denver area among the 200 largest U.S. metro areas.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au, 2024 American Community Survey 1-year estimates.
